    11 pages, 4 figures, 3 tables, supporting information https://dx.doi.org/10.1111/1755-0998.13111.-- All data related to this publication are publicly available: mapped reads and methylation values of each CpG for each sample can be found in https://doi.org/10.5061/dryad.m0cfxpnz4 Anastasiadi & Piferrer, 2019)Age‐related changes in DNA methylation do occur. Taking advantage of this, mammalian and avian epigenetic clocks have been constructed to predict age. In fish, studies on age‐related DNA methylation changes are scarce and no epigenetic clocks have been constructed. However, in fisheries and population dynamics studies there is a need for accurate estimation of age, something that is often impossible for some economically important species with the currently available methods. Here, we used the European sea bass, a marine fish the age of which can be determined with accuracy, to construct a piscine epigenetic clock, the first one in a cold‐blooded vertebrate. We used targeted bisulfite sequencing to amplify 48 CpGs from four genes in muscle samples and applied penalized regressions to predict age. We thus developed an age predictor in fish that is highly accurate (0.824) and precise (2.149 years). In juvenile fish, accelerated growth due to elevated temperatures had no effect on age prediction, indicating that the clock is able to predict the chronological age independently of environmentally‐driven perturbations. An epigenetic clock developed using muscle samples accurately predicted age in samples of testis but not ovaries, possibly reflecting the reproductive biology of fish. In conclusion, we report the development of the first piscine epigenetic clock, paving the way for similar studies in other species.     Trabajo final presentado por Guillermo Gambús Gubern para obtener el grado, realizado bajo la dirección del Dr. Francesc Piferrer del Institut de Ciències del Mar (ICM-CSIC).-- 24 pagesSexual determination in some fish is still unknown and it has been studied that abiotic factors such as temperature, density, pH and hypoxia have an influence in this process. Based on previous experiments, we analysed density factor in domesticated zebrafish (AB strain), which has a masculinizing effect in a population, subjected to high density treatments. Six different were set up for the experiment, combining low (16 fish/L) and high (66 fish/L) densities in order to determine which period(s) were more sensitive to this factor during zebrafish sexual development having a masculinizing effect, because there were not studies looking for the critical periods. Experiment had a duration from one until 90 days post fertilization, dpf. The results obtained showed that high density treatments had significant differences with low density treatments, having a masculinizing effect. Treatments that spanned (7–18 dpf) and (7–45 dpf) obtained the same percentage of males, making the period (7–18 dpf) the most sensitive during sexual differentiation and having a masculinizing effect, affecting negatively in the growth (body weight and standard length) of this fish speciesPeer Reviewe

    Epigenetic mechanisms, influenced by intrinsic and environmental factors are crucial for the regulation of gene expression and, ultimately, the phenotype. The European sea bass is used as a model to study these influences on DNA methylation and the phenotype during early development and later in life. We identify loci altered with age, suggestive of the existence of a piscine epigenetic clock. We show that moderate early developmental temperature increases are associated with genome-wide changes in DNA methylation and with parent-specific responses of genes involved in sexual development. Furthermore, we highlight a genome-wide inverse relationship of gene expression with the DNA methylation of the first intron. Lastly, we provide one of the first empirical demonstrations in support of the neural crest cell deficit hypothesis to explain Darwin’s domestication syndrome. Together, these results constitute the most integrative analysis of DNA methylation patterns in a fish species under intrinsic and ecologically relevant contexts.Els mecanismes epigenètics són crucials per a la regulació de l'expressió gènica.     The present study examines one of the fundamental aspects of author co-citation analysis (ACA) - the way co-citation counts are defined. Co-citation counting provides the data on which all subsequent statistical analyses and mappings are based, and we compare ACA results based on two different types of co-citation counting - the traditional type that only counts the first one among a cited work's authors on the one hand and a non-traditional type that takes into account the first 5 authors of a cited work on the other hand. Results indicate that the picture produced through this non-traditional author co-citation counting contains more coherent author groups and is therefore considerably clearer. However, this picture represents fewer specialties in the research field being studied than that produced through the traditional first-author co-citation counting when the same number of top-ranked authors is selected and analyzed. Reasons for these effects are discussed

    “Variations on the Author” discusses two of Eduardo Coutinho’s recent films (Um Dia na Vida, from 2010, and Últimas Conversas, posthumously released in 2015) and their contribution to the general question of documentary authorship. The director’s filmography is characterized by a consistent yet self-effacing form of authorial self-inscription: Coutinho often features as an interviewer that rather than express opinions propels discourses; an interviewer that is good at listening. This mode of self-inscription characterizes him as an author who is not expressive but who is nonetheless markedly present on the screen. In Um Dia na Vida, however, Coutinho is completely absent form the image, while Últimas Conversas, on the contrary, includes a confessional prologue that moves the director from the margins to the center of his films. This article examines the ways in which these works stand out in the filmography of a director who offers new insights into the notion of cinematic authorship

    We provide a number of new insights into the methodological discussion about author cocitation analysis. We first argue that the use of the Pearson correlation for measuring the similarity between authors’ cocitation profiles is not very satisfactory. We then discuss what kind of similarity measures may be used as an alternative to the Pearson correlation. We consider three similarity measures in particular. One is the well-known cosine. The other two similarity measures have not been used before in the bibliometric literature.
